Political commentator and noted author Nick Adams is vocal about sports. However, his latest remarks on the LSU upset win against Alabama in OT did not go well with the NFL fans. Several users asked Donald Trump’s favorite author to stop tweeting about the game. 

ADVERTISEMENT

Article continues below this ad

Earlier, the No.10 LSU Tigers downed the No. 6 Alabama Crimson Tide 32-31 in overtime. The result has sent the SEC West, SEC, and College Football playoff dreams into a spin. A dramatic result downplayed by heavy criticism has made Twitter users ask what happened to the young author.

NFL fans loved the high drama

It was a stunning upset. No one saw it coming. Meanwhile, the result has put Brian Kelly’s group to record back-to-back wins. The last minutes of the clash saw great drama. However, The Tigers converted the two-point try to give the Tide a second loss on the season. It has likely put an end to the latter’s College Football Playoff hopes.
